On Tue, Aug 10, 2021 at 03:24:40PM +1000, Dave Chinner wrote:
From: Dave Chinner <redacted> Convert the xfs_sb_version_hasfoo() to checks against mp->m_features. Checks of the superblock itself during disk operations (e.g. in the read/write verifiers and the to/from disk formatters) are not converted - they operate purely on the superblock state. Everything else should use the mount features. Large parts of this conversion were done with sed with commands like this: for f in `git grep -l xfs_sb_version_has fs/xfs/*.c`; do sed -i -e 's/xfs_sb_version_has\(.*\)(&\(.*\)->m_sb)/xfs_has_\1(\2)/' $f done With manual cleanups for things like "xfs_has_extflgbit" and other little inconsistencies in naming. The result is ia lot less typing to check features and an XFS binary size reduced by a bit over 3kB: $ size -t fs/xfs/built-in.a text data bss dec hex filenam before 1130866 311352 484 1442702 16038e (TOTALS) after 1127727 311352 484 1439563 15f74b (TOTALS) Signed-off-by: Dave Chinner <redacted> Reviewed-by: Christoph Hellwig <hch@lst.de> Reviewed-by: Darrick J. A regression test that I developed to test the act of adding a realtime volume to an existing filesystem exposed the following failure:
--- /tmp/fstests/tests/xfs/779.out 2021-08-08 08:47:08.535033170 -0700
+++ /var/tmp/fstests/xfs/779.out.bad 2021-08-11 14:54:18.389346401 -0700@@ -1,2 +1,4 @@ QA output created by 779 +/opt/a is not a realtime file? +expected file extszhint 0, got 12288 Silence is golden
Since this test is not yet upstream, I will describe the sequence of events: 1. Suppress SCRATCH_RTDEV when invoking _scratch_mkfs. This creates a filesystem with no realtime volume attached. 2. Mount the fs with SCRATCH_RTDEV in the mount options. The rt volume still has not been attached. 3. Set RTINHERIT (and EXTSZINHERIT) on the root directory. Make sure the extent size hint is not a multiple of the rt extent size. 4. Call xfs_growfs -r to add the rt volume into the filesystem. 5. Create a file. Due to RTINHERIT, the new file should be a realtime file. 6. Check that the file is actually a realtime file and does not have an extent size hint. The regression of course happens in step 6, because xfs_growfs_rt can add a realtime volume to an existing filesystem. Prior to this patch, the "has realtime?" predicate always looked at the mp->m_sb. Now that the feature state has been turned into a separate xfs_mount state, we must set the REALTIME m_feature flag explicitly. The following patch solves the regression:
diff --git a/fs/xfs/xfs_mount.h b/fs/xfs/xfs_mount.h
index 09d4195b6427..b69cce671243 100644
--- a/fs/xfs/xfs_mount.h
+++ b/fs/xfs/xfs_mount.h@@ -319,6 +319,11 @@ __XFS_HAS_FEAT(inobtcounts, INOBTCNT) __XFS_HAS_FEAT(bigtime, BIGTIME) __XFS_HAS_FEAT(needsrepair, NEEDSREPAIR) +static inline void xfs_add_realtime(struct xfs_mount *mp) +{ + mp->m_features |= XFS_FEAT_REALTIME; +} + /* * Flags for m_flags. */
diff --git a/fs/xfs/xfs_rtalloc.c b/fs/xfs/xfs_rtalloc.c
index 7361830163d7..4bde66fd7b5a 100644
--- a/fs/xfs/xfs_rtalloc.c
+++ b/fs/xfs/xfs_rtalloc.c@@ -1130,6 +1130,9 @@ xfs_growfs_rt( error = xfs_trans_commit(tp); if (error) break; + + /* Make sure the incore feature flags get updated */ + xfs_add_realtime(mp); } if (error) goto out_free;
I can fold this in if you like. --D
